How to pass multiple searches from a form?

I have a search that crosses multiple indexes and sourcetypes, and the customer wants the ability to choose these searches (all or multiple) and have them run. I have macros set up for the searches, and it looks like Multi-select is the option to use in the form, but I can't figure out how to pass these as parameters in the search. Can someone help me out?

If your searches append to each other as plain text you could store those searches in the value of your input, and use the input's token as the sole search.

That's usually not the case though, most combination searches are more complicated than that. In such a case you can use placeholder values in your input, and set the actual search token using a conditional set element in simple XML: http://docs.splunk.com/Documentation/Splunk/6.3.3/Viz/PanelreferenceforSimplifiedXML#Eval.2C_Link.2C...
